Description
A vest worn by Melvin Van Peebles as the title character of "Sweet Sweetback's Baadasssss Song." The vest is made of gold-colored velvet with an orange silk lining. It is hip-length, with slits at the bottom of each side seam and a low neckline. At front center is a round metal belt buckle closure. An interior black label with gold text reads, "Mr. Jan / MADE IN / CALIFORNIA."
